Description

This effort is for the manufacture and delivery of quantity one (1) of INSPECTION SET, RESIDUAL STRESS-MLG, one (1) TEST SET, CAPTURE LOCK-MAIN LANDING GEAR as indicated in the table listed in the Statement of Work (SOW) and the CLIN Structure Attachment of this solicitation. This procurement is in support of the F/A-18 E/F program. In accordance with the attachments in this solicitation, the submitted proposal must be accompanied by all supporting data and facts used to develop the proposal that are accurate, current, and complete to allow Government evaluators to make their independent assessments. Written rationale is requested to define calculations and assumptions made when preparing the proposal. Please provide actuals and any other information that supports the proposed cost elements for each task, Basis of Estimate (BOE). The proposal should include all labor hours and rates proposed by labor category, as well as material, subcontractors, overhead and other direct costs that the Contractor expects to incur in this effort. A proposal received without sufficient supporting data and rationale, such as inadequate cost/pricing data, will delay the procurement award and/or will result in the proposal being rejected by the Procuring Contract Officer. The Contractor and any subcontractors must provide certified cost and pricing data in accordance with FAR 15.403-4 that meet or exceed the $2,000,000 threshold. In accordance with FAR 15.406-2, a Certificate of Current Cost or Pricing Data is required from the Contractor any subcontractors, certifying that the cost or pricing data submitted in support of the proposal are current, accurate, and complete. The Contractor shall complete and provide the checklist in accordance with DFARs 252.215-7009 identifying whether each of the criteria are met and provide a copy with the submission of the proposal. For major subcontracts over $2,000,000, please include a completed cost and pricing analysis in accordance with FAR 15.404-3(b).
